>Description:
When installing virtualbox via pkg_add virtualbox-ose -r the first package, virtualbox-ose, downloaded.  However, the dependent package qt4-doc.4.7.4 does not complete download.  The download just stops with no network activity.

My filesystem has 28.3 GB of free space.

Filesystem 1K-blocks    Used    Avail Capacity  Mounted on
/dev/da0p2  36116700 3553112 29674252    11%    /


BRSINC-BSDHST# pkg_add virtualbox-ose -r
Fetching ftp://ftp.freebsd.org/pub/FreeBSD/ports/amd64/packages-9.0-release/Latest/virtualbox-ose.tbz... Done.
Fetching ftp://ftp.freebsd.org/pub/FreeBSD/ports/amd64/packages-9.0-release/All/qt4-doc-4.7.4.tbz...

>How-To-Repeat:
I tried to use this same technique to install virtual box several times and I encounter the same problem over a two day period.

 Though I initially believed that I was out of disk space when I first
 reported this download problem that was only a secondary issue.  The
 package virtualbox-ose would download but not the qt4 package.  I was,
 however, able to resolve this by downloading the qt4 package via ftp
 manually and the installing it from the local disk.  pkg_add subsequently
 downloaded and installed the remaining dependent packages.  qt4 is a
 sizable package and the download simply quits about 2/3 of the way
 through.  This does not appear to be a package issue so I would suggest
 closing both this BR and 164195.
